  • Ayurvedic Benefits

    • Supports Detoxification & Liver Health: Sarsaparilla root contains plant compounds like saponins and flavonoids, which have been shown in studies to bind to toxins and support their removal from the body. Research suggests these compounds may assist liver function by promoting the breakdown and elimination of metabolic waste, contributing to overall detoxification pathways.

    • Anti-Inflammatory & Joint Support: Scientific studies have identified anti-inflammatory properties in sarsaparilla, particularly due to its antioxidant content. These compounds may help reduce inflammatory markers in the body, which is beneficial for joint comfort and conditions like arthritis. Some traditional and modern research indicates it may help inhibit endotoxins that contribute to inflammation.

    • Rich in Antioxidants for Immune Health: Sarsaparilla root is a source of antioxidants that help combat oxidative stress by neutralizing free radicals. This oxidative damage is linked to aging and chronic disease. Laboratory studies suggest these antioxidant effects may support immune system function and help protect cells from damage over time.
